Owen Burrows' son of Blue Point REMMOOZ created a good impression when going in at the first time of asking over C&D and can defy a 6 lb penalty here unless Ralph Beckett's Kingman newcomer Circios proves well above average. Al Joory, Watch And Shoot and Wolfpack all need factoring in too for minor honours.
